Synopsis:
The Psycho Pirate still has Green Lantern [Alan Scott] under his spell and later enchants the Flash [Jay Garrick] as the rest of the JSA try to stop him at his Earth-1 hidden headquarters. He is defeated by Wildcat's punch, who was unaffected by his fear gaze. Meanwhile, Bruce Wayne plans to arrest the JSA as he calls in for some heavy backup while the JSAers are still on Earth-1 in the JLA satellite.
